Tweets On TricorBraun’s Twitter Keep The Trade In Touch

Wednesday 08. April 2009 - TricorBraun has begun to encourage electronic discussion about rigid packaging among its customers, suppliers and staff through a Twitter account.

Twitter is a new social networking service that allows individuals to use the Internet to exchange informal messages of 140 characters in length—called “tweets.”

TricorBraun’s Twitter site can be accessed at www.twitter.com/tricorbraun.

Twitter is a companion to the TricorBraun blog, which provides readers with in-depth insight about an array of packaging issues. The blog can be found at http://www.tricorbraun.com/learn-packaging/packaging-blog/.

In late 2008, TricorBraun launched a new Web site, which was designed to serve as both an educational and purchasing resource for rigid packaging. “The addition of Twitter provides another conduit to communicate, quickly and inexpensively, with others in the dynamic field of the packaging industry,” according to Suzie Fenton, director of marketing, TricorBraun.

TricorBraun is one of the world’s leading suppliers of rigid packaging, and it has 33 offices in the United States, Canada and Asia.
